The Kent Police Department is urging residents to use extra caution on the roads as snow and icy conditions affect travel throughout the day. With winter weather continuing in the forecast, officers warn that roads may be slick and require additional travel time.
City plow crews are currently active, focusing first on major roads, hills, and bridges before moving to secondary streets. Police thanked public works staff for their ongoing efforts to clear snow and apply salt.
Authorities also reminded drivers to fully clear snow and ice from their vehicles before hitting the road. This includes windows, headlights, and brake lights. Driving with obstructed visibility can result in a traffic citation.
Residents are advised to slow down, allow for longer stopping distances, and plan for delays as winter conditions persist.
